Australia: Outback Experiences: 3-Day Essence of Oz
The Cooktown "Essence Of Oz" is a 3 day 4WD accommodated safari which will show you ancient rainforests and outback landscapes, ancient Aboriginal rock art, Cook’s adventures, a rollicking Gold Rush, amazing feats of exploration and pioneering hardships.
Day 1: You will head west over the Great Dividing Range into an outback landscape of termite mounds and cattle stations, to stop at Split Rock. At Split Rock you will climb the sandstone escarpment to view some ancient Aboriginal rock art depicting life and customs here thousands of years ago.

Day 2: Guests will have the opportunity to walk where Captain Cook once walked, and touch the sand where the “Endeavour” was beached. You will visit Grassy Hill, from where the famous navigator plotted his escape route, and visit the James Cook Historical Museum. The tour will visit eerie Black Mountain and the Lion’s Den Hotel before the rugged 4WD Bloomfield Track takes you to Cape Tribulation and the Daintree rainforest. You can walk in the World Heritage listed rainforest to see the wondrous plants of this primeval jungle, the oldest rainforest on Earth. Once finished your guide will check you in to your rainforest resort and explain self-guided activities available nearby.
